CT Scans
Medical imaging procedures that use computer-processed combinations of multiple X-ray measurements taken from different angles to produce cross-sectional images of specific areas of a scanned object, allowing the user to see inside without cutting.
MRI Scans
A medical imaging technique that uses powerful magnets and radio waves to create detailed images of the organs and tissues within the body.
Brain Anatomy
The study of the structure and organization of the brain, including its various areas, functions, and connections between them.
Peripheral Nervous System
The part of the nervous system that lies outside the central nervous system, consisting of nerves and ganglia that connect the brain and spinal cord to the limbs and organs.
